From 60b7e19fe5d7ac5943a2cf454ef1fed32d6e88b4 Mon Sep 17 00:00:00 2001 From: Dan Goodliffe Date: Sun, 10 Jan 2016 18:53:05 +0000 Subject: Correct permissions of members in DB client --- icetray/icetray/abstractCachingDatabaseClient.h | 2 +- icetray/icetray/abstractDatabaseClient.h |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/icetray/icetray/abstractCachingDatabaseClient.h b/icetray/icetray/abstractCachingDatabaseClient.h index fd67e03..5a59867 100644 --- a/icetray/icetray/abstractCachingDatabaseClient.h +++ b/icetray/icetray/abstractCachingDatabaseClient.h @@ -12,7 +12,7 @@ namespace IceTray { typedef std::vector CacheKey; typedef boost::any CacheItem; - public: + protected: AbstractCachingDatabaseClient(DatabasePoolPtr d); template diff --git a/icetray/icetray/abstractDatabaseClient.h b/icetray/icetray/abstractDatabaseClient.h index aac9151..0661e24 100644 --- a/icetray/icetray/abstractDatabaseClient.h +++ b/icetray/icetray/abstractDatabaseClient.h @@ -8,7 +8,7 @@ namespace IceTray { class DLL_PUBLIC AbstractDatabaseClient { - public: + protected: AbstractDatabaseClient(DatabasePoolPtr d); template @@ -22,7 +22,6 @@ namespace IceTray { return Slicer::DeserializeAny(*s); } - private: template static void inline bind(int offset, DB::Command * cmd, const Param & p, const Params & ... params) { -- cgit v1.2.3